(a) Local health department personnel shall complete state approved training in the following areas:
- (1) Enforcement of statutes and regulations relating to mislabeling, false advertising and adulteration of foods in retail food establishments.
- (2) Observation and recording of violative conditions in narrative reports that can be used for legal actions.
- (3) Determining alcoholic proof of liquor products for mislabeling and candling of full or partly filled liquor bottles to determine adulteration.
- (4) Procedures for voluntary condemnation and destruction of violative food products.
- (5) Procedures for the embargo of violative food products and the release of an embargo.
- (6) Collection of representative official samples of violative food and potential adulterants.
- (7) Completing official sample receipt forms and memorandum of instruction for laboratory examinations.
- (8) Procedures for the forfeiture, condemnation and destruction of food found to be adulterated or misbranded.
- (9) Preparation of statements of facts for referrals of violative conditions to the district attorney.
Note: Authority cited: Sections 208, 26202 and 26590, Health and Safety Code. Reference: Section 26590, Health and Safety Code.
